John Abraham, present hot star and teenage sensation of Bollywood,
began his early years of education at the Bombay Scottish School. He did his
Bachelors in Economics and then went on to do MMS from Mumbai Educational Trust
(MET). He was working as a Media Planner at Enterprise-Nexus, an ad agency in
Mumbai, when one day, a model ditched the shoot and his Boss suggested his name
for doing the work. After that he got a hand full of offers and took up modeling
as his career. His big break came in 1999, when he won the Glad Rags Manhunt
Contest and went to Singapore for Manhunt International, where he won the second
place. The half Keralite and half Iraninian, with his international looks, great
body, innocent smile and down to earth personality easily became the highest
paid supermodel in India.
He made his debut in Hindi films in 2003 with an erotic emotional
movie 'Jism', which immediately pushed him into the public eye. The same year
came the paranormal 'Saaya' (2003) and romantic 'Paap' (2003), both of them
failed to click at the box-office. His first blockbuster hit was 'Dhoom' (2004),
a thriller loosely based on the Hollywood flick the 'Fast and the Furious',
in which he did his role of an evil guy convincingly. His next notable film
was 'Madhoshi' (2004) where his screen presence and the credibility with which
he plays Aman add vitality to the film.
In
2005, he did a lot of films- the list includes 'Elaan', 'Karam', 'Kaal', 'Viruddh',
'Water' and 'Garam Masala'. He acted well in 'Elaan' most of the time, but went
overboard in sequences that demanded an outburst. He overcame this fault in
his next film 'Karam', where he enacted the role of an assassin working for
a mob boss, and made a sincere effort to live up to his role. In 'Kaal', he
showed signs of a gifted actor and his performance bolstered his position in
Bollywood. His next movie was 'Viruddh', with superstar Amitabh Bachchan, where
he stood on his feet in every sequence.
Deepa Metha's 'Water', a film about the ill treatment of widows
in the 1930s, was his next film where he played the role of an idealist lawyer
and got wide international attention. Then he appeared in Priyadarshan's 'Garam
Masala' where he made a very brave and largely honest attempt to play the clumsy
but conniving pal convincingly. He came up with cool candour in some sequences.
He followed his success with memorable performances in 'Zinda' and 'Taxi No.9211',

John takes special care of his physique and is considered
to be a male sex symbol in Hindi Films. He has endorsed many products like Pepsi
and now has his own apparel line John Abraham by Wrangler. A romantic at heart,
he is involved with Bipasha Basu, fellow actress and believes in the celebration
of life. John is crazy about bikes and goes riding whenever he gets a chance.
Recently he was voted as the 'Sexiest actor in India' in a Durex Global Sex
survey.
